> What does $TERM say in your shell?  Is this terminal type known to

> support color?  If so, specifying such a terminal type is an error and

> we try and figure out where it comes from so we can fix it.

Well running in eshell echo $TERM gives no output. and I often get the error message "tput: No value for $TERM and no -T specified". Running the command export TERM="dumb" stops the error messages, but the program still outputs in color.

Note that the program probably doesn't work correctly with a non-color shell, as it is meant as an advancement on another program, so it is unlikely the developers tested it with a non-color term.

However, I'm not sure how relevant this is to this bug, as if eshell can be made to work easily with color, then why not set it as default?
